  • Publication number: 20220278945
    Abstract: Novel tools and techniques are provided for implementing intent-based orchestration using network parsimony trees. In various embodiments, in response to receiving a request for network services that comprises desired characteristics and performance parameters for the requested network services without information regarding specific hardware, hardware type, location, or network, a computing system might generate a request-based parsimony tree based on the desired characteristics and performance parameters. The computing system might access, from a datastore, a plurality of network-based parsimony trees that are each generated based on measured network metrics, might compare the request-based parsimony tree with each of one or more network-based parsimony trees to determine a fitness score for each network-based parsimony tree, and might identify a best-fit network-based parsimony tree based on the fitness scores.

  • Publication number: 20220240603
    Abstract: Fabrics and garments are disclosed that have dual protection against flash fires and electrical arc flashes. The fabrics can be made from spun yarns containing an intimate blend of fibers. The fibers contained in each yarn can include modacrylic fibers, natural cellulose fibers, and inherently flame resistant fibers.

  • Patent number: 11326973
    Abstract: An agricultural combine having a chassis, an intermediate member connected to the chassis, a first actuator connecting the chassis to the intermediate member, a first gauge configured to measure a first force generated by the first actuator, a header movably connected to the intermediate member, a second actuator connecting the header to the intermediate member, a second gauge configured to measure a second force generated by the second actuator, and a processing unit operatively connected to the first gauge and to the second gauge and comprising a processor and a memory, the memory storing computer readable instructions that, when executed by the processor, are configured to evaluate the first force and the second force to determine a position of a center of gravity of the header relative to the chassis. A method for determining the position of the center of gravity and weight of the header are also provided.

  • Publication number: 20220053860
    Abstract: Fabrics and garments are disclosed that have dual protection against molten metal splashes and electrical arc flashes. The fabrics can be made from spun yarns containing an intimate blend of fibers. The fibers contained in each yarn can include wool fibers, flame resistant cellulose fibers, and nylon fibers. In one aspect, relatively long wool fibers are incorporated into the yarns.

  • Patent number: 11197416
    Abstract: A control system and method for controlling the positioning of an adjustable deflector plate employed in a harvesting combine to adjust a side-to-side flow of crop residue to spreaders associated with the combine and the distribution thereby. The deflector plate is operably extendable into the flow of crop residue to redirect crop residue impinging the deflector plate. The deflector plate is adjusted based upon a comparison between the open/closed states of valves associated with the control system.

  • Patent number: 10995905
    Abstract: A pressurized gaseous and liquified hydrocarbon feedstock storage system method. The system includes a plurality of underground circuits or sections having parallel pipes joined together by radial ends arranged in various configurations to minimize plot space and maximize the amount of pressurized gaseous fuel stored.

  • Patent number: 9970277
    Abstract: Systems and methods for transporting seawater from a seawater source to an inland site for utilization as a drilling and/or fracturing fluid are disclosed. In an aspect, systems and methods are disclosed wherein seawater is pumped from an ocean at a coastal location and transported to an inland drilling and hydraulic fracturing site, thereby providing a consistent, large volume supply of seawater for use in drilling and/or hydraulic fracturing operations. Such systems and methods may eliminate usage of locally-sourced fresh water, eliminating the unsustainable burden that drilling and hydraulic fracturing places on local water tables.
